Abstract :
The importance of early fire detection can help in providing warnings and avoid disaster that led to the economic damage and loss of life. Fire detection techniques with conventional sensors have limitations, which require a long time to detect a fire, especially in a large room and cannot work in the open area. This study proposed a fire detection method, to detect the possibility of fire based on visual sensor using multi-color feature such as color, saturation, luminance, background subtraction and time frame selection for fire detection. The evaluation in this studies conducted by calculating the error rate of the fire detection.
